Describe the Indian Caste System

Hierarchical system that keeps people within a certain socio-economic group. The only way to move between castes is reincarnation. Brahmans at the top, Kshatriyas, Vaisyas, and Shudras at the bottom.

How are the terms 'habit,' 'custom,' and 'culture' related?

An act repeated by an individual is a habit. If multiple people perform a habit, it becomes a custom. Multiple customs performed or observed by a group constitute a culture.
